Ukrainian soldiers fly cat and dog 12 km to safety by drone

Ukrainian soldiers have evacuated a cat and a dog from frontline positions using an unmanned aerial vehicle which flew the animals 12 km to safety.
Source: UAnimals, a Ukrainian animal welfare organisation, which has posted a video showing the rescue efforts
Quote: "Fighters from the 14th Prince Roman the Great Separate Mechanised Brigade were sending food to their brothers-in-arms at a position. The drone that delivered the supplies returned with some passengers on board – a cat and a dog."
Details: UAnimals reported that the pets travelled 12 km by drone. The cat had been looked after by a soldier who is now in hospital with injuries, and his brothers-in-arms decided to rescue his pet. The soldiers could not bear to leave the dog behind at the position either.
Background: Earlier, volunteers in Oleksiievo-Druzhkivka in Donetsk Oblast spent two days rescuing a Shar Pei dog that had been trapped for a month on the fifth floor of a building destroyed by a Russian attack.
